Protecting RV Appliances and Electronics with Surge Protection Devices
Surge protection devices (SPDs) are specifically designed to intercept and divert surges of electrical energy, preventing them from causing damage to the sensitive electronics and appliances in your RV. In addition, they also provide excellent filtering and noise reduction capabilities that help keep sensitive components clean and healthy.
Surge protection devices can be categorized mainly into two types:
- Non-Semiconductor Surge Protectors: These include fuses, circuit breakers, and metal-oxide varistors (MOVs) that absorb the energy of the surge, and then release it to the ground, preventing it from affecting the sensitive components in your RV.
- Semiconductor Surge Protectors: These protect against high-energy spikes by using components such as diodes and silicon carbide (SiC) to redirect the energy to the ground. They also have the ability to respond to the level of voltage in the electrical system.
By using surge protection devices, you can ensure that the essential appliances and electronics in your RV are well-protected, keeping you connected, healthy, and secure on the road.
Always choose a high-quality surge protector that has been certified by organizations like UL (Underwriters Laboratories) or ETL.

Installation and Maintenance of RV Surge Protectors
Installing an RV surge protector is a crucial step to ensure the safety and reliability of your RV’s electrical system. A surge protector is a vital safety device that protects your electrical system from damage caused by power surges, spikes, and electrical storms. Proper installation and maintenance of RV surge protectors are essential to ensure their effectiveness and longevity.
Importance of Proper Installation
Proper installation of an RV surge protector involves several key steps to ensure it functions correctly and effectively. Here are some of the most important aspects to consider:
- Choosing the right location: The surge protector should be installed as close to the electrical panel as possible to ensure it can respond quickly to electrical fluctuations. This is typically near the RV’s electrical system or electrical panel.
- Proper wiring: Ensure that the surge protector’s wiring is properly connected to the RV’s electrical system. Use the correct wiring gauge and color-code the wires according to the manufacturer’s instructions.
- Secure the unit: Secure the surge protector to the RV’s floor or a secure mounting bracket to prevent it from moving or falling during transportation or use.

Maintenance Tips
To ensure your RV surge protector remains effective and reliable, follow these regular maintenance tips:
- Regularly inspect the surge protector: Check for signs of wear, damage, or corrosion on the unit and its connections.
- Clean the connections: Use a soft brush or cloth to clean the surge protector’s connections to prevent corrosion and ensure reliable operation.
- Check the wiring: Verify that the wiring connections to the RV’s electrical system are tight and secure.
- Update firmware: If your surge protector has software updates available, install them to ensure optimal performance and protection.

Effective Use of Surge Protectors
- Surge protectors come in various types, including whole-house surge protectors, point-of-use surge protectors, and multi-outlet surge protectors.
- Whole-house surge protectors protect the entire RV’s electrical system, while point-of-use surge protectors protect specific appliances or devices.
- Multi-outlet surge protectors are designed to protect multiple devices from power surges, making them ideal for RVs with multiple appliances.
- Surge protectors can be installed at the main electrical panel of the RV or at individual appliance panels.
- Some surge protectors are designed to automatically reset after a power surge, while others may need to be manually reset.
